Abominable Dr. Phibes, The (1971)
Rating:
Starring: Joseph Cotten, Vincent Price, Hugh Griffith, Virginia North, Terry Thomas
Director: Robert Fuest
Category: Science-Fiction, Horror, Independent, Cult, Classic
Studio: MGM / UA

Revenge Is The Best Medicine.

Meet Doctor Phibes: a one-time concert musician who's now an all-time crazed murderer.In this clever, crypt-kicking classic, horrormeister Vincent Price plays a diabolical doc seeking the ultimate in revenge with precision creepiness and surgical wit.Watch Dr. Phibes live up to his promise: "Nine killed her, nine shall die, nine eternities in doom!"

After a team of surgeons botch his beloved wife's surgery, leaving her for dead, the emotionally distraught Dr. Phibes creatively concocts a fatal prescription for revenge.Using the Good Book as his guide, Phibes unleashed a score of old testament atrocities -- from a plague of locusts to an attack of rats -- on his enemies that climax in what may be one of "the eeriest endings on screen record" (Syracuse Herald-Journal)!
